Abstract: The challenges posed by war have had a significant impact on the Ukrainian education system. This article aims to provide an overview of the current stage of training specialists in higher education institutions, highlighting the development trends of specific professions. Attention is drawn to the crucial role of teachers in fostering educational competencies in students, thereby enhancing their competitiveness in the job market, particularly in the context of war. “…Today's Ukrainian realities have proven that digital technologies are a unique mechanism for modeling the educational environment, because they offer an opportunity for rapid exchange of experience and knowledge, adaptation of online learning, its integration with offline learning, or development of digital libraries (Martynenko, 2023). Also, the special attention is paid to the significance of development of digital educational environment during full-scaled Russian-Ukrainian war (Galynska & Bilous, 2022;Sibruk et al, 2023) since it helps ensure continuity of learning through digital resources and technologies and establish positive collaboration between the participants of educational process. Some works are related to the improvements of higher education due to application of digital tools.…”
